+/*!
+ * \internal
+ * \brief Attempt to reclaim unused heap memory.
+ *
+ * Users have reported that asterisk will sometimes be killed because it can't allocate
+ * more than around 3G of memory on a 32 bit system.
+ *
+ * Using malloc_trim() will help us to determine if it's because there's a leak or because
+ * the heap is so fragmented that there isn't enough contiguous memory available.
+ *
+ * \note malloc_trim() is a GNU extension and is therefore not portable.
+ */
